Description
Automating the coupling and decoupling process for trailers can reduce or eliminate many known safety issues. Additionally, only a single operator will be required, and the overall duration will be shorter. As the Autonomy Kit (A-Kit) provider for the Expedited Leader Follower (ExLF) and Autonomous Ground Resupply (AGR) programs, Robotic Research is in a unique position to implement an autonomous trailer solution. Robotic Research is a leader in planning and control of Unmanned Ground Vehicles (UGVs) and has demonstrated successful executions of complex maneuvers in both forwards and reverse. This proficiency, combined with extensive experience with the PLS vehicles and trailers, gives Robotic Research a significant advantage in creating a solution. A sensor suite must be added to the rear of the PLS, containing cameras, lidars, or a combination of the two. These sensors will allow for the tracking of the trailer while the A-Kit autonomously maneuvers the vehicle. Once the vehicle is aligned with the trailer, the drawbar must be lifted until the sensor suite identifies it is at the proper height. The vehicle then continues backing up autonomously, ensuring that the trailer is successfully coupled. The proposed system eliminates the need for personnel to be near the trailer while the vehicle is reversing, removing the risk of injury. Hitching the trailer will be simulated to demonstrate the A-Kit’s capability to maneuver the vehicle into position. Several sensor configurations will be evaluated during Phase I to identify the optimal balance between cost and reliability. These configurations will be incorporated into the simulation to verify the accuracy required for the maneuvers. We call our technology ATCH (Autonomous Trailer Couple/decouple via Hitch).
